The Google Nexus 7 has a global score of 59.3, which is a bit better than the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L's general score of 58.3. These tablets use Android OS (Operating System), but Google Nexus 7 has newer 5.1 version while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L has Android 4.4 version. The Google Nexus 7 construction is notably lighter but just a bit thicker than the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L.
The Google Nexus 7 features just a bit better display than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L, although it has a way smaller display, a little bit lower pixels density and a lot worse resolution of 800 x 1280 pixels. The Google Nexus 7 has just a little better processing power than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L, because although it has a smaller amount of RAM, and they both have 4 cpu cores, the Google Nexus 7 also counts with an additional graphics processor.
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L features a superior storage capacity for games and applications than Google Nexus 7, and although they both have the same 32 GB internal memory capacity, the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L also has a SD memory slot that admits a maximum of 64 GB. The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L shoots much clearer photos and videos than Google Nexus 7.
Google Nexus 7 features a much better battery lifetime than Asus Transformer Pad TF303CL.
